‘Pet Nat Barawarain’

‘Pet Nat Barawarain’

Grüner Veltliner & Gelber Muskateller, Weinviertel, Austria

A floral, mineral and freshly-baked Austrian pet-nat for celebrating. Brand new to Ontario, fifth generation winemaker Katharina Gessl crafts her low-intervention lineup based on gut instincts, patience and dedication. Her winery bridges between classic and modern, sitting in the town of Zellerndorf, a part of Austria’s largest wine-growing region, Weinviertel, of Lower Austria. ‘Barawarain’ (translation, worker) is a 50/50 blend of citric, mineral grüner veltliner and aromatic, spiced gelber muskateller were grown on calcarious soils, hand harvested, and saw a six hour, whole cluster maceration before pressing – and of course underwent a second fermentation in bottle to trap jaunty levels of C02. Musky florals, brioche with blackcurrant jelly, dried thyme, underripe pear skins, key lime custard & a shimmering pool of minerality disturbed only by the animated bubbles. Enjoy while reading the poetry of Pablo Neruda, maybe snacking on a crudité.
